It has recently been recognized by the author that the quantum contextuality
paradigm may be formulated in terms of the properties of some subgroups of the
two-letter free group G and their corresponding point-line incidence geometry
G. I introduce a fundamental homomorphism f mapping the
(infinitely many) words of G to the permutations ruling the symmetries of
G. The substructure of f is revealing the essence of geometric
